3․2 Indoor Use Requirements
ProForm treadmills are designed for indoor use only․ Place the treadmill on a level, stable surface away from moisture, dust, and direct sunlight․ Avoid positioning it in garages, covered patios, or near water sources․ Use a protective mat under the treadmill to prevent floor damage․ Ensure the area is well-ventilated and free from aerosol products or oxygen administration․ This ensures optimal performance and longevity of the equipment․
- Keep the treadmill away from humidity and extreme temperatures․
- Ensure proper ventilation in the room during use․

5․2 Cleaning and Dust Protection
Regular cleaning is essential for maintaining your ProForm treadmill’s performance․ Dust and dirt can damage the motor and belt, so use a soft cloth to wipe down the console and frame․ Vacuum under the belt and clean the rollers to prevent dust buildup․ Avoid using harsh chemicals, as they may damage the surfaces․ Keep the treadmill indoors, away from moisture and direct sunlight, to protect it from environmental wear․ Regular maintenance ensures longevity and optimal functionality․
